There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Cactus is 21.6% cheaper than Graham. With a cost index of 60 vs 77,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Cactus to Graham should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.

On the housing front, median rent in Cactus is $725/month compared to $970/month in Graham — a 25%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Cactus is more affordable at $61,300 median vs $173,000.

Median household income in Cactus is $49,125 compared to $58,525 in Graham (-16.1%). The higher salaries in Graham partially offset the cost difference, but don't fully close the gap. Looking at affordability, residents of Cactus spend roughly 17.7% of their income on rent, less than the 19.9% in Graham.
